  20. When I was dinking around trying to figure out if the spec was actually awful or not I tried all kinds of crazy nonsense and was pretty settled on 0 alacrity. When I got my first decent parse I realized I'd forgotten to swap my alacrity out from playing hatred. I've only gotten over 4720~ with one piece of alacrity. The last few days I've been trying to beat my current parse, and I realized you run into a dead zone of force when you go past one piece of alacrity, because vanish isn't affected by alacrity. I'm really not great at advanced math (except for tank stuff, and even then I'm no KBN), but after I swapped I see MUCH more consistent parses with the old 4-piece and have only gone over 4800 with the old set. I also parse much higher on boss fights with the old set. If it's mathematically better, my parse has all the info you could need to beat my parse, so do it and I'll swap
